Manager, Partnership Development | Full-Time | TD Coliseum
Overview
TD Coliseum is seeking a dynamic and results-driven Manager, Partnership Development to lead new partner acquisition efforts. This role is specifically responsible for identifying and securing strategic partnerships that drive revenue growth for the incoming Hamilton AHL Team playing out of TD Coliseum. The successful candidate will have a deep understanding of integrated partnership sales, a developed business network in the Greater Hamilton region and a strong ability to cultivate relationships with key decision-makers.
This role pays an annual salary of $60,000-$75,000 CAD and is bonus eligible.
Benefits for Full-Time roles: Health, Dental and Vision Insurance, Pension matching, and Paid Time Off (vacation days, sick days, and statutory holidays).
This position will remain open until July 17, 2026.
